Zulu is what is called a “softphone.” This means that it functions as a phone, but operates on your computer without a physical or “hard” handset.
How to Install Zulu on a St. Olaf Mac computer
You must be on campus, connect via ethernet or eduroam, to install the Zulu software. If you are off-campus, either connect to the VPN (and then follow steps 1-3) or download the software using the link found in the Personal Computer section below.
- In the upper right corner of your Mac, select the spotlight icon.
- Search for Self Service.
- From the list of applications, find Zulu Softphone and select Install.
How to Install Zulu on a St. Olaf Windows computer
You must be on campus, connect via ethernet or eduroam, to install the Zulu software. If you are off-campus, either connect to the VPN (and then follow steps 1-3) or download the software using the link found in the Personal Computer section below.
- In lower left corner, click on the Windows icon.
- Search for Software Center.
- From the list of applications, find Zulu Softphone and select Install.

How to Login to Zulu:
Open the Zulu software and enter the following information:
- User: enter <username>@vox.stolaf.edu replacing <username> with your St. Olaf username.
- Password: Enter your St. Olaf password.
- Port: do not change the Port number.
- Select Remember me if you are the sole user of the device. This will allow you to stay logged in.
Once you've entered the user and password, select Login.
